CITY CYCLING 2025 - interim results at the halfway point

Kilometres can still be collected until 21 May 2025 // Measure distances online, add them or report them in writing

The first half of the CITY CYCLING 2025 campaign is over! With over 330,000 kilometres cycled so far, Bocholt is in first place nationwide among municipalities in the 50,000 - 100,000 inhabitants size category. Now it's time to pedal hard for the remaining period and continue collecting kilometres!

The three-week campaign period will run until Wednesday, 21 May 2025, with over 27,000 journeys by more than 2,500 cyclists covering almost 340,000 km for Bocholt as a cycling city (as of 12 May). A total of 280 teams have cycled in Bocholt so far, including over a fifth of the city councillors who have joined one of these teams.

"However, these figures are only snapshots and are constantly increasing", explains Sascha Terörde from the Climate Protection Unit, who is coordinating the project for the city this year. "The main aim is to predominantly use the bicycle as a means of transport and leave the car behind", he explains.

All CITY CYCLING participants can enter the kilometres they have cycled online at www.stadtradeln.de or record them directly in the CITY CYCLING app using GPS tracking - it is also possible to enter them at a later date. Any difficulties can be reported by sending an email to klimaschutz(at)bocholt(dot)de or by calling 02871 953-3002. In the event of problems, there is also the option of submitting completed written kilometre forms. These can be downloaded from the City of Bocholt website or requested by post.

All kilometres are counted up to 21 May - however, anyone who has registered during the campaign period can also add kilometres to their personal online calendar in the following seven days (up to 28 May) or have them added via the city of Bocholt.

About the STADTRADELN campaign

"CITY CYCLING" is a campaign of the "Climate Alliance", in which more than 1,800 cities, municipalities and districts in 28 countries have joined forces to protect the global climate. In Germany alone, hundreds of thousands of citizens, including many local politicians, will be cycling for three weeks in a row from May 2025. Together, they will collect cycle kilometres for "a good climate" and for increased cycling promotion in their respective local communities. The most bicycle-active local parliaments and municipalities nationwide and the most hard-working teams and cyclists locally are then determined.
